A return to the Park for Super Rygbi Cymru Cup second round

Action returns to Carmarthen Park this Saturday as we take on Pontypool in the second round of the Super Rygbi Cymru Cup. 54-42

It was Ebbw Vale who took the spoils, 24-7, in the opening round last weekend at Eugene Cross Park. The Gwent side now sit atop of Pool B with six points. Pontypool and Swansea battled it out with the Pooler eventually taking the spoils 32-31.

In Pool A RGC have pride of place at the top of the table having secured a 54-42 home victory over Aberavon. Cardiff lost 40-33 away from home to Llandovery.

Loosehead prop James Newnian will lead the Quins in the cup second round clash. Lewis Morgan returns at hooker for his first outing since October with Ifan James on the tighthead.

Iestyn Wood gets his first start of the season in the second row and links up with the experienced lock Ryan Bean.

Young flanker Taine Morgan takes his place on the blindside with Tom Curry returning to the field for the first time this year. 18-year-old Scarlets Academy member Keanu Evans packs down at number 8.

Scarlets Academy pair Rhodri Lewis and Ellis Payne link up at 9 and 10 with fellow Academy member Gabe McDonald lining up in midfield.

Dylan Richards and Iestyn Gwilliam take their place on the wing, Jac Howells links up with McDonald in midfield with Eilir George at fullback.
